What Makes the Canon Elph 360 Special?

At its core, the Canon Elph 360 is a compact powerhouse. Its most talked-about feature is the impressive 12x optical zoom lens, which allows you to capture distant subjects with stunning clarity without sacrificing image quality. Paired with effective image stabilization, this zoom capability means you can shoot sharp photos even at full telephoto or in low-light conditions, making it perfect for everything from wildlife to sports photography.

The camera's connectivity is another major win. Being a Wi-Fi & NFC enabled camera, the Elph 360 makes sharing your photos and videos incredibly easy. You can instantly transfer images to your smartphone or tablet for quick editing and social media posting, a feature that modern photographers truly appreciate. Perfect for Travel and Everyday Use

The Canon Elph 360 excels as a travel photography companion. Its compact size slips easily into a pocket or small bag, yet it doesn't compromise on features. The 12x zoom lets you capture expansive landscapes and architectural details alike, while the Wi-Fi capability means you can share your journey in real-time. As a point and shoot camera, it's incredibly intuitive, yet it offers enough manual control to grow with your skills.
